Short-Term Rental Regulations
in Colonial Heights, VA

Last verified: March 2026 · Report an update

Zoning & Conditions

STRs are limited to 5% of units per neighborhood and a maximum of 180 rental days per year. Occupancy is capped at twice the number of bedrooms (max 6 guests), and at least one off-street parking space is required per dwelling. Commercial events and on-site advertising are prohibited.

How to Obtain a Permit

1. Submit the Short-term Rental Permit application to the Department of Planning and Community Development with a $500 annual fee. 2. Pass a mandatory safety inspection by the Building Official and Fire Marshal. 3. Upon approval, the permit is valid for the calendar year and must be renewed annually with proof of transient occupancy tax payments.
